Output fc20a358f63a6bcde1ffea18c113f24c4587382b87b616ecf14b2fcbb59ddab8:2

value
3960159259
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 105875cccac95fb78e9aa54c20d57541aeecbfd86dfac1a87ffac39f8eee5e2a
address
tb1pzpv8tnx2e90m0r5654xzp4t4gxhwe07cdhavr2rlltpelrhwtc4qvw53t5
transaction
fc20a358f63a6bcde1ffea18c113f24c4587382b87b616ecf14b2fcbb59ddab8
confirmations
27850
spent
true